SDCL § 9-5-10: Proceedings to compel compliance with terms of annexation--Existing rights and liabilities preserved.
Where this section sits in the code
- TITLE 9. MUNICIPAL GOVERNMENT
- CHAPTER 9-5. ANNEXATION OF CONTIGUOUS MUNICIPALITIES
Any citizen of the annexed municipality may maintain legal proceedings to compel the municipality and the governing body thereof, to which annexation is made, to execute such terms and conditions, but such annexation shall not affect or impair any rights or liabilities then existing for or against either of such municipalities, and they may be enforced as hereinafter provided.
